|  | <A NAME="sec2"><H3>Summary</H3></A> | 
|  | <P>Unary function object that returns the negation of its argument</P> | 
|  | <A NAME="sec3"><H3>Synopsis</H3></A> | 
|  |  | 
|  | <PRE>#include <functional> | 
|  |  | 
|  | namespace std { | 
|  | template <class T> | 
|  | struct negate : public unary_function<T, T>; | 
|  | } | 
|  | </PRE> | 
|  | <A NAME="sec4"><H3>Description</H3></A> | 
|  | <P><B><I>negate</I></B> is a unary function object. Its <SAMP>operator()</SAMP> returns the inverse of its argument. For boolean arguments, <SAMP>operator()</SAMP> returns <SAMP>true</SAMP> if its argument is <SAMP>false</SAMP>, or <SAMP>false</SAMP> if its argument is <SAMP>true</SAMP>. For numeric arguments, <SAMP>operator()</SAMP> returns the additive inverse of the argument. You can pass a <B><I>negate</I></B> object to any algorithm that requires a unary function. For example, the <SAMP><A HREF="transform.html">transform()</A></SAMP> algorithm applies a unary operation to the values in a collection and stores the result.   <B><I>negate</I></B> could be used in that algorithm in the following manner:</P> | 
|  |  | 
|  | <UL><PRE>vector<int> vec1; | 
|  | vector<int> vecResult; | 
|  | . | 
|  | . | 
|  | . | 
|  | transform(vec1.begin(), vec1.end(), vecResult.begin(), | 
|  | negate<int>()); | 
|  | </PRE></UL> | 
|  | <P>After this call to <SAMP><A HREF="transform.html">transform()</A></SAMP>, <SAMP>vecResult(n)</SAMP> contains the negation of the element in <SAMP>vec1(n)</SAMP>.</P> | 
|  | <A NAME="sec5"><H3>Interface</H3></A> | 
|  |  | 
|  | <UL><PRE>namespace std { | 
|  |  | 
|  | template <class T> | 
|  | struct negate : unary_function<T, T> { | 
|  | T operator() (const T&) const; | 
|  | }; | 
|  | } | 
|  | </PRE></UL> |
